func (v *VolumeEntry) Expand(db *bolt.DB,
	executor executors.Executor,
	allocator Allocator,
	sizeGB int) (e error) {

	// Allocate new bricks in the cluster
	brick_entries, err := v.allocBricksInCluster(db, allocator, v.Info.Cluster, sizeGB)
	if err != nil {
		return err
	}

	// Setup cleanup function
	defer func() {
		if e != nil {
			logger.Debug("Error detected, cleaning up")

			// Remove from db
			db.Update(func(tx *bolt.Tx) error {
				for _, brick := range brick_entries {
					v.removeBrickFromDb(tx, brick)
				}
				err := v.Save(tx)
				godbc.Check(err == nil)

				return nil
			})
		}
	}()

	// Create bricks
	err = CreateBricks(db, executor, brick_entries)
	if err != nil {
		logger.Err(err)
		return err
	}

	// Setup cleanup function
	defer func() {
		if e != nil {
			logger.Debug("Error detected, cleaning up")
			DestroyBricks(db, executor, brick_entries)
		}
	}()

	// Create a volume request to send to executor
	// so that it can add the new bricks
	vr, host, err := v.createVolumeRequest(db, brick_entries)
	if err != nil {
		return err
	}

	// Expand the volume
	_, err = executor.VolumeExpand(host, vr)
	if err != nil {
		return err
	}

	// Increase the recorded volume size
	v.Info.Size += sizeGB

	// Save volume entry
	err = db.Update(func(tx *bolt.Tx) error {

		// Save brick entries
		for _, brick := range brick_entries {
			err := brick.Save(tx)
			if err != nil {
				return err
			}
		}

		return v.Save(tx)
	})

	return err

}
